Transaction 12594381c79cefe7d521269ad96001fb55b74872960c03311c9bd1a43d001fcd
1 Input
1 Output
-
12594381c79cefe7d521269ad96001fb55b74872960c03311c9bd1a43d001fcd:0
- value
- 381584
- script pubkey
- OP_0 OP_PUSHBYTES_20 120965981b956441186816c698b73c62f8c55fd7
- address
- bc1qzgyktxqmj4jyzxrgzmrf3deuvtuv2h7hz3mvl6